What are the Key Components of UI for CRM?

The following are the essential components of UI for CRM:

User Interface (UI)

The user interface is the part of the CRM system that employees and customers interact with. It’s how they access, view, and manipulate data. A good UI should be intuitive, user-friendly, and visually appealing.

Clean Design

A clean design is essential in ensuring that the UI is visually appealing and easy to navigate. A good design should be simple, organized, and consistent.

Intuitive Navigation

The navigation should be easy to understand and logical. Employees should be able to find what they need quickly, and customers should be able to access relevant information with ease.

Usability

The usability of the system is how easy it is to use to complete tasks. A good UI should be designed to simplify tasks and eliminate unnecessary steps to ensure employees can work productively.

Customization

Having a system that is customizable is essential in ensuring that the CRM system can fit your business needs. A customizable UI allows you to tailor the system to match your business processes and workflows.

Accessibility

Accessibility refers to the system’s ability to be accessed across different devices, including mobile devices. A system that is accessible from different devices helps boost productivity by allowing employees to work from anywhere.

Integration

The ability to integrate with other systems and software your business uses is critical in ensuring that your CRM system is efficient. A system that can integrate with other tools can help automate tasks, reducing manual effort and boosting productivity.

A good UI should be designed with these components in mind. By ensuring that your CRM system has these components, you can improve productivity, boost user adoption, and enhance the overall customer experience.

Why is UI Important in CRM?

A well-designed UI is essential for several reasons:

Boosts Productivity

A well-designed UI simplifies tasks, allowing employees to work more efficiently. With an intuitive and easy-to-use system, employees can focus on their work without getting bogged down with complicated processes.

Boosts User Adoption

A good UI ensures that employees can navigate the system with ease, reducing the learning curve. This boosts user adoption, as employees are more likely to use a system that is easy to understand and use.

Enhances Customer Experience

Customers are more likely to enjoy working with a business that has an efficient and effective CRM system. A good UI ensures that customers can access relevant information, making communication more manageable and efficient.

How to Implement an Effective UI for Your CRM System

To implement an effective UI for your CRM system, you should follow these steps:

Step 1: Understand User Needs

Understand what your employees and customers need from the system. This will help you design a UI that is tailored to their needs.

Step 2: Keep It Simple

Avoid clutter and keep your UI simple. A simple design is easier to understand and navigate, leading to a more efficient CRM system.

Step 3: Focus on Functionality

Ensure that the system is functional and fulfills the needs of your employees and customers. Focus on the essential features and avoid overcomplicating the system.

Step 4: Test Your Design

Test your design to ensure that it is user-friendly and efficient. Get feedback from employees and customers and make adjustments where necessary.
